Story: Microfiction

 Microfiction

100-word story: Life as we know is filled with endless amounts of the unknown, and that just alone is intimidating and scary. The unknown ultimately causes stress and anxiety to surface for me. Tension weighs me down, intrusive thoughts fill my mind, and I go down the dangerous rabbit hole of intense and overwhelming overthinking. But one thing that keeps me grounded is you. I don’t know what the future holds or what will happen in a couple years down the line, but it is safe to say, without a doubt, that I know you will be a part of my life.

6-word story: Part of my life till the end.


Author's Note: The 100-word and 6-word story are both about feeling anxieties in life and not knowing what the future holds. It can be overwhelming when you do not know how secure the future will be for you, but having the people that you love in your life can bring you ease.
